The Reality of Dental Implant Investment in Oman
Before diving into the numbers, it is crucial to understand what you are actually paying for. Unlike temporary bridges or removable dentures, a dental implant is a complex surgical procedure. It involves placing an artificial tooth root directly into your jawbone. Over time, through a natural biological process called osseointegration, this titanium fixture fuses with your bone, creating a foundation as strong as a natural tooth.

Exact Breakdown: Average Cost of Dental Implants in Muscat
To give you the clearest picture possible, we have gathered the latest 2026 data from top-rated implant dentists in Muscat. Keep in mind that these figures are averages and can fluctuate based on the clinic's reputation and location.
Single Tooth Implant Price in Muscat
For a straightforward case where a patient needs a single front tooth implant cost in Muscat or a single molar replaced, the pricing usually covers three distinct phases: the implant post (the root), the abutment (the connector), and the crown (the visible tooth).
| Component of Procedure | Estimated Cost Range (OMR) | Purpose in the Procedure |
|---|---|---|
| Consultation & 3D Scans | 20 OMR – 50 OMR | Assessing jaw bone density and planning. |
| Surgical Placement (Post) | 250 OMR – 450 OMR | Inserting the titanium or zirconia root. |
| Abutment Placement | 50 OMR – 100 OMR | Connecting the hidden root to the visible crown. |
| Crown Placement | 150 OMR – 300 OMR | Custom-made ceramic or zirconia visible tooth. |
| Total Estimated Average | 470 OMR – 900 OMR | Complete single tooth restoration. |
Actionable Tip: Always ask your clinic if their quoted "single tooth implant price in Muscat" includes the crown. Some clinics advertise a surprisingly low rate, only for the patient to discover it only covers the surgical insertion of the artificial tooth root!
Multiple Teeth and All-on-4 Dental Implants Cost Muscat
If you are missing several teeth or an entire arch, replacing them one by one is neither practical nor financially viable. This is where advanced solutions come in.
- Multiple Teeth Implant Packages Muscat: Instead of placing an implant for every missing tooth, a periodontist can place two implants at either end of a gap and attach a permanent bridge holding three or four teeth. This significantly reduces the overall cost.
- All-on-4 Dental Implants Cost Muscat: This is a revolutionary full mouth dental implant cost Muscat residents frequently inquire about. It involves supporting an entire upper or lower arch of teeth on just four strategically placed implants. The cost for an All-on-4 procedure in Muscat generally ranges from 2,500 OMR to 4,500 OMR per arch. While it sounds like a large upfront investment, it is significantly cheaper than replacing 14 individual teeth and offers an incredible, permanent smile restoration.

5 Key Factors Influencing Your Dental Implant Price
Why does one patient pay 500 OMR while another pays 900 OMR at the same clinic? The variation in the best dental clinic for implants in Muscat comes down to several critical, personalized factors.
1. Material Quality: Titanium vs. Zirconia
The materials used in your mouth directly impact the longevity and aesthetic of your new teeth.
Most implants are made of high-grade titanium. The titanium dental implants price Muscat clinics offer is generally the standard because titanium is incredibly durable, biocompatible, and has a 95%+ success rate.
However, some patients prefer or require ceramic. The zirconia dental implants cost in Muscat is typically 15% to 20% higher than titanium. Zirconia is completely metal-free, which is excellent for patients with rare metal allergies, and it prevents any dark lines from showing at the gum line, making it ideal for a front tooth implant.
Furthermore, the brand of the implant matters immensely. When a clinic utilizes the 5 Best Implant Brands in Muscat (such as Straumann, Nobel Biocare, or Osstem), the materials cost more, but they come with decades of clinical research guaranteeing their safety and durability.
Average Price Breakdown by Implant Brand (Surgical Post Only):
| Dental Implant Brand | Origin / Quality Tier | Estimated Price Range (OMR) |
|---|---|---|
| Osstem / Dentium | South Korea (Standard) | 250 OMR – 350 OMR |
| Zimmer / BioHorizons | USA (Premium) | 350 OMR – 450 OMR |
| Nobel Biocare | Switzerland/USA (Elite) | 400 OMR – 550 OMR |
| Straumann | Switzerland (Elite) | 450 OMR – 600 OMR |
2. The Need for Preparatory Oral Surgery
If you have been missing a tooth for a long time, the bone in that area naturally begins to shrink (a process called resorption). Before an implant can be placed securely, you must have adequate jaw bone density.
If your bone is too thin, your dentist will require a preparatory procedure. The cost of bone grafting for dental implants Muscat usually adds anywhere from 100 OMR to 300 OMR to your total bill, depending on the volume of bone graft material required. Similarly, if upper back teeth are being replaced, a sinus lift might be necessary, adding further surgical costs.
3. Surgeon's Expertise: General Dentist vs. Specialist
You are paying for the hands that hold the scalpel. A general dentist who has taken a weekend course on implantology will likely charge less than a highly specialized Prosthodontist or Periodontist who has dedicated years of postgraduate education specifically to complex dental prosthetics and gum architecture. When researching top rated implant dentists in Muscat, remember that paying a slight premium for an expert drastically reduces the risk of complications like implant failure or nerve damage. 4. Technological Advancements (Painless and Same-Day Options)
Modern dentistry in Oman has evolved rapidly. If you are terrified of the dentist chair, you might opt for painless dental implants in Muscat, which involve advanced local anesthesia techniques or conscious sedation. Sedation will add a separate fee to your bill.
Additionally, the same day dental implants cost Muscat clinics offer is usually higher. This premium service, sometimes called "Teeth in a Day," utilizes highly advanced 3D surgical guides and immediate load implants, allowing you to walk in with missing teeth and walk out with a fully functioning (though temporary) fixed smile the very same afternoon.

Uncovering the Hidden Costs of Dental Implants Muscat
When calculating your budget, it is critical to look beyond the initial advertised sticker price to avoid bill shock. Ensure you account for these often-overlooked hidden costs:
- Dental Implant Consultation Fee Muscat: While some clinics offer free initial chats, a comprehensive consultation involving a Prosthodontist and a personalized treatment plan usually costs between 20 OMR and 50 OMR.
- Cone Beam Computed Tomography (CBCT): A standard 2D X-ray is not enough for safe implant placement. A 3D CBCT scan is mandatory to map out your nerves and bone structure. This can cost an additional 30 OMR to 70 OMR if not included in the main package.
- Extractions: If you have a severely decayed tooth that needs to be removed before the implant can be placed, tooth extraction is billed as a separate oral surgery procedure.
- Medications and Aftercare: Prescribed antibiotics, high-strength pain relievers, and specialized antibacterial mouthwashes for post-operative care will add a small, but necessary, cost at the pharmacy.
Does Insurance Cover Dental Implants in Oman?
A major concern for patients is dental implant insurance coverage Oman. Historically, health insurance providers in the Middle East have categorized dental implants strictly as a "cosmetic" procedure, refusing any coverage.
However, the landscape of Oman dentistry is slowly shifting. If your tooth loss is the result of an accident, trauma, or a documented severe medical condition, specific premium insurance tiers might cover a portion of the surgical extraction or the crown placement. The titanium fixture itself is rarely covered fully.

Real-Life Example: Ahmed's Journey to a Restored Smile
To understand how these numbers play out in reality, consider a typical patient scenario in Muscat. Ahmed, a 45-year-old professional, lost a lower molar due to severe decay five years ago. Because he waited, he experienced minor gum recession and bone loss.
When he visited a specialist for a single tooth implant price in Muscat, his treatment plan looked like this:
- Month 1: Comprehensive 3D scan and consultation (40 OMR).
- Month 1: Minor bone grafting to ensure a solid foundation (150 OMR).
- Month 4: After the bone healed, surgical placement of a premium Swiss titanium fixture (400 OMR).
- Month 7: Osseointegration complete; placement of the abutment and a highly durable Zirconia crown designed to withstand heavy chewing forces (250 OMR).
Ahmed's Total Investment: 840 OMR.

Checklist: How to Choose the Right Clinic in Muscat
Do not make your decision based on price alone. Finding the best dental clinic for implants in Muscat requires looking for value, safety, and expertise. Use this checklist during your consultations:
- Check Qualifications: Is the dentist placing the implant a registered specialist (Periodontist/Prosthodontist/Oral Surgeon) or a general practitioner?
- Ask About the Brand: Request the name of the implant brand. If they use obscure, uncertified materials to offer cheap tooth replacement options Muscat, walk away.
- Request a Total Written Quote: Ensure the quote explicitly includes the implant, abutment, crown, all surgical fees, and necessary scans.
- Inquire About Guarantees: Reputable clinics stand by their work. Ask if they offer a warranty on the titanium fixture in the rare event of an implant failure.
- Tour the Facility: Assess the clinic's hygiene standards and check if they have modern 3D CBCT scanning equipment on-site. Clinic reputation is everything.
